The American Mercury was an American magazine published from 1924 to 1981. It was founded as the brainchild of H. L. Mencken and drama critic George Jean Nathan. The magazine featured writing by some of the most important writers in the United States through the 1920s and 1930s. After a change in ownership in the 1940s, the magazine attracted conservative writers. A second change in ownership a decade later turned the magazine into a virulently anti-Semitic publication. It was published monthly in New York City. The magazine went out of business in 1981, having spent the last 25 years of its existence in decline and controversy. Glossy hard cover, no dust as issued. Born near Kingston, Ontario on 18 July 1860, Trotter arrived in Manitoba as a telegraph worker on the Canadian Pacific Railways construction gangs. After living for a time in Regina, North West Territories (now Saskatchewan), in 1883 he became a horse dealer and livery stable owner at Brandon. In 1925, he wrote A Horseman and the West, a book about the early days of Brandon. He served as a Brandon municipal councilor and was a member of the Odd Fellows and United Church.
